Academic Foundations: A Deep Dive into Computer Science
Nicolas Kokkalis’ journey begins in Greece, where a fascination with computing led him to pursue higher education in one of the world’s most respected programs. Holding a Ph.D. in Computer Science from Stanford University, his research focused on decentralized systems and social computing long before the wider public understood the potential of blockchain.
Throughout his doctoral studies, Kokkalis delved into systems that enable trustless cooperation among distributed participants. He contributed to several peer-reviewed academic publications—one especially relevant study examined incentivization mechanisms for crowdsourced tasks, an area that would later inform his work on Pi Network’s user-driven consensus model.
Beyond personal accolades, Kokkalis maintained a passion for education, serving as an instructor for Stanford’s popular “Designing Decentralized Applications on Blockchain” course. Many students remember his ability to distill complex technical topics into actionable frameworks, a skill that translates directly to Pi Network’s user-friendly ethos.
Pi Network: Reimagining Cryptocurrency for the Masses
The Genesis of Pi Network
In 2019, the crypto landscape was dominated by heavy, resource-intensive coins like Bitcoin and Ethereum. Kokkalis, along with Dr. Chengdiao Fan and Vincent McPhillip, recognized a gap: the vast majority of people lacked both technical expertise and hardware resources to participate in mining or running blockchain nodes.
With Pi Network, their vision was radical yet practical—a cryptocurrency that could be mined on mobile devices without draining battery life or requiring specialized hardware.
“Our aim was to democratize access to the future of finance, by enabling anyone with a smartphone to participate, not just early adopters or tech elites,” Kokkalis told a Stanford blockchain symposium.
Pi Network’s core innovation lies in its use of the Stellar Consensus Protocol variant, which allows for lightweight validation by leveraging users’ trust circles. The app gamifies the mining process, rewarding social engagement and creating viral growth among a largely non-technical audience. Within three years of launch, Pi Network had attracted tens of millions of users in over 150 countries—a growth trajectory mirroring the early days of Facebook or WhatsApp.
Navigating Controversies and Building Trust
Rapid expansion, however, brought scrutiny. Critics questioned the project’s long “enclosed mainnet” phase and delays in enabling coin withdrawal or external trading. While supporters pointed to the need for robust security and compliance, skeptics argued over whether the project could deliver real value.
Kokkalis addressed these concerns in multiple forums, advocating patience and transparency. He consistently emphasized Pi Network’s gradual rollout as a deliberate measure to prioritize sustainability and regulatory readiness over short-term speculation. While full mainnet launch and external exchange listings remain awaited, Pi’s active developer community and pilot merchant ecosystem keep users engaged.

FAQs
Who is Nicolas Kokkalis?
Nicolas Kokkalis is a Stanford-educated computer scientist and entrepreneur, most notably the co-founder and leading force behind Pi Network, a mobile-first cryptocurrency platform.
What is Pi Network and why is it significant?
Pi Network is a cryptocurrency ecosystem that lets users mine coins from their smartphones using minimal resources. Its goal is to make blockchain participation accessible to the masses, especially those outside of traditional crypto circles.
How does Pi Network differ from other cryptocurrencies?
Unlike currencies like Bitcoin that require intensive computing power, Pi Network uses a novel consensus mechanism allowing mobile mining without significant energy consumption or hardware investment.
Is Pi Network a legitimate project?
Pi Network has garnered both excitement and skepticism due to its unique approach and measured rollout. While it continues to develop toward broader adoption, it has published whitepapers and maintains an open development roadmap to build trust.
